Output 10954a0870152096fe93dfd84f5a594c8ce085d1647f7cc205a22a0dc5729617:60

value
15193
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0044ddcb67db200ce4782d2156c09f1e6f6d1d52c580f49b94c54c924521d6d6
address
bc1pqpzdmjm8mvsqeerc95s4dsylrehk682jckq0fxu5c4xfy3fp6mtqp9nrkn
transaction
10954a0870152096fe93dfd84f5a594c8ce085d1647f7cc205a22a0dc5729617
spent
true